Das Standard-Rollout eines MCG-Werkzeug wird nur dann automatisch generiert, wenn die Eigenschaft Benutzerdefinierte UI leer ist. Wenn Sie MAXScript in der Eigenschaft Benutzerdefinierte UI verwenden, um ein MCG-Werkzeug zu erweitern, und Sie kein benutzerdefiniertes Rollout definieren möchten, dann müssen Sie das Standard-Rollout wiederherstellen.
Verwenden Sie dazu den folgenden Code:
rollout params "Parameters" ( -- Restore the rollout UI elements <<ParamUIDefs>> -- Restore any rollout events required by lists or other pecific parameters <<RolloutParamsHanders>> ) -- Your custom MAXScript goes here
Die Markierungen <<ParamUIDefs>> und <<RolloutParamsHanders>> werden durch den Code für die UI-Steuerelemente ersetzt, die normalerweise automatisch erstellt werden, wenn die Eigenschaft Benutzerdefinierte UI leer ist. Dies ist eine von mehreren Markierungen, die Sie in der Eigenschaft Benutzerdefinierte UI verwenden können.
Für Simulationsdiagramme sollten Sie auch die Markierung <<SimRollout>> hinzufügen, um das Rollout Simulation mit der Schaltfläche Simulation zurücksetzen wiederherzustellen. Beispiel:
rollout params "Parameters" ( -- Restore the rollout UI elements <<ParamUIDefs>> -- Restore any rollout events required by lists or other pecific parameters <<RolloutParamsHanders>> ) -- Restore the Simulation rollout <<SimRollout>> -- Your custom MAXScript goes here